Description - Recently refurbished throughout, this well-proportioned two-bedroom home offers spacious accommodation ideally suited to first-time buyers and investors alike.

Entering the property via the front door, you are welcomed into an entrance vestibule which leads directly into the main reception room (4.22m x 4.26m). This generous living space provides ample room for a range of furniture configurations, easily accommodating sofas, media units and additional storage. A window to the front elevation allows for plenty of natural light, while a chimney breast positioned to the right-hand side creates a natural focal point within the room.

From the reception room, access is provided through a small inner hallway where the staircase wraps around to the left, with useful understairs storage located beneath. This leads through to the recently fitted kitchen (3.19m x 2.47m), thoughtfully designed to maximise both space and practicality. The sink is positioned beneath a window overlooking the rear yard, and the kitchen benefits from a newly installed oven and electric hob. There is designated space for a washing machine and fridge freezer within and alongside the fitted counter units, making this a functional and modern cooking space.

To the first floor, the master bedroom (4.20m x 4.30m) is a particularly impressive size, offering generous proportions and flexibility for a range of large freestanding furniture including a double bed, bedside tables, wardrobes and additional storage units.

The second bedroom (2.96m x 1.84m) overlooks the rear of the property and would make an ideal child’s bedroom, guest room or home office, catering perfectly to modern living requirements.

Completing the accommodation is the bathroom (2.01m x 2.35m), fitted with a three-piece suite comprising bath, wash basin and WC. The boiler is also conveniently located within this room.
